Madeleine Laracy is a prominent legal figure in New Zealand, currently serving as the Deputy Solicitor-General. In her role, she is responsible for overseeing significant criminal cases and providing legal advice to government agencies. She gained attention for her work in high-profile cases, including the appeal of Scott Watson, where she represented the Crown and argued against claims of miscarriage of justice.
